Description

Inpro is seeking an experienced Extrusion Set-Up Technician to support our 24/7 Extrusion manufacturing operations. In this hands-on role, you'll be responsible for setting up production lines, performing equipment changeovers, troubleshooting issues, and helping operators achieve safe, efficient, and high-quality production.


What You'll Do

  • Set up and shut down extrusion lines for production runs.
  • Perform die, sizer, screw, and tooling changeovers.
  • Assist operators with production start-ups and troubleshooting.
  • Perform routine floor-level maintenance on extruders, tooling, and downstream equipment.
  • Diagnose equipment issues to minimize downtime and maintain productivity.
  • Ensure products meet quality standards through inspections and process verification.
  • Perform quality audits and document required production and quality information.
  • Partner with Shift Leads, Supervisors, Maintenance, Quality, and other departments to keep production running efficiently.
  • Help train operators on equipment operation, troubleshooting, and best practices.
  • Assist with updating work instructions and standard operating procedures.
  • Promote a safe, clean, and organized work environment.
  • Support continuous improvement initiatives and other duties as assigned.
